There are many reasons to shank, it's identifying the right one.

It's quite common for your hands to suddenly creep a bit closer to your body, especially if you're trying too hard or if you're tired. From that jammed position there's no where to go apart from outside the line.. shank.

The quickest fix that I can think of is to make sure that your hands are a good 6 inches away from your body at address and that will create some room so you can drop slightly inside the ball on the way down... no shank.
